Executive summary

  • Achieved net profit of RMB292.0 billion in 2025, up 3.3% year-over-year, with operating income of RMB725.1 billion, up 1.9%.

  • Total assets reached RMB48.8 trillion, up 12.8% from the previous year; total loans grew 8.9% to RMB27.13 trillion.

  • Asset quality remained sound with a non-performing loan (NPL) ratio of 1.27%, down 3 bps year-over-year.

  • Maintained a capital adequacy ratio of 17.93% and a cash dividend payout ratio above 30%.

Financial highlights

  • Net interest income was RMB569.6 billion, down 1.9% year-over-year due to lower market rates.

  • Net fee and commission income rose 16.6% to RMB88.1 billion, driven by wealth management and agency distribution.

  • Operating expenses increased 5.4% to RMB275.4 billion; cost-to-income ratio rose to 35.18%.

  • Credit impairment losses decreased 2.8% to RMB127.2 billion.

  • Return on average total assets was 0.63%; return on weighted average net assets was 10.16%.

Outlook and guidance

  • 2026 marks the start of the 15th Five-Year Plan, with focus on rural revitalization, real economy support, and risk management.

  • Plans to increase credit supply to key sectors, enhance digital and AI-driven services, and maintain strong risk controls.

  • Expects stable economic growth in China, with continued policy support for infrastructure, consumption, and technology.
